Kashmir is a destination for every season and has long been an inspiration for poets, writers, and filmmakers. The beautiful Chinars, the famous gardens, the unique culture, and the lakes with their floating gardens have enthralled travellers. Ladakh’s awe-inspiring landscapes is where the magnanimity of the Himalayas is seen at its best. Karan Mahal
Kashmir
Step into the royal grandeur of Karan Mahal in Srinagar, a residence steeped in history and regal charm. Here, amidst lush
Mughal gardens and serene Dal Lake views, the legacy of Kashmir's monarchs comes alive, offering guests a taste of royal
living and the cultural heritage of the region.

Sukoon Houseboat
Kashmir
Set in a corner of Dal Lake, Sukoon Houseboat is an exquisite example of Kashmiri craftsmanship and legacy. Wake to the soft
sounds of water and explore the floating markets or simply soak in the panoramic views of the snow-capped mountains.

Nadis
Kashmir
Immerse yourself in the essence of Kashmir at Nadis Hotel, where each element of the decor and ambience is thoughtfully
aligned with local aesthetics and sustainability. Located close to Harwan Garden, it’s an ideal base for those wishing to explore
the many facets of Kashmiri culture.

The Grand Dragon
Ladakh
In the heart of Leh, The Grand Dragon stands as a great example of Ladakhi hospitality. With panoramic views of the Stok
Kangri Mountains, the hotel blends modern amenities with traditional design, making it a perfect year-round destination for
adventure and culture enthusiasts.

The Apricot Tree Hotel
Ladakh
Located on the banks of the Indus River, The Apricot Tree Hotel celebrates the heritage of Ladakh’s apricot orchards. The
hotel's design incorporates local materials and techniques, offering guests a sustainable stay without compromising on
comfort and elegance.

Ladakh Sarai
Ladakh
Experience the quintessential Ladakh at Ladakh Sarai Resort, where traditional architecture meets the rugged natural beauty
of the valley. The resort's yurt-style accommodations provide a cosy retreat after a day of exploring Buddhist monasteries or
trekking through dramatic landscapes.

Lchang Nang Retreat
Ladakh
Nestled in the picturesque Nubra Valley, Lchang Nang Retreat, known as the 'House of Trees,' is a sanctuary amidst apricot
and apple orchards. Embrace tranquillity and reconnect with nature in this eco-friendly stay that offers personalized
experiences in one of the most remote areas of India.

The LUNGM?R Remote Camp
Ladakh
For those who seek adventure off the beaten path, The LUNGM?R Remote Camp is an unparalleled choice. This seasonal
camp in the Changthang region offers an authentic nomadic experience, with access to some of the most untouched
landscapes of Ladakh.
